Solange Piaget Knowles-Smith (born June 24, 1986 in Houston, Texas) is an American actress, R&B singer and songwriter. She is the younger sister of popular singer and Destiny's Child member Beyoncé Knowles. She is managed by her father, Matthew Knowles, who also manages Destiny's Child. Her mother is of Creole descent and father of African American ancestry.

In 2002, Knowles released her debut single, "Feelin' You", from her debut album, Solo Star, which was released in January 2003. The album debuted in the top 50 of the U.S. Billboard 200 albums chart.

Solange also appeared on the Destiny's Child holiday album "8 Days of Christmas", (released in 2001), singing back up vocals on "Little Drummer Boy".

On February 27, 2004, at the age of 17 years, Knowles married Texas Southern University football player Daniel Smith. On October 18, 2004, they had a son named Daniel Julez Smith.

She was in Johnson Family Vacation, starring Cedric the Entertainer and also co-starring Vanessa L. Williams, Bow Wow, Steve Harvey and Shannon Elizabeth.
